Bleecker Street has a Walk Score of 99 out of 100. This location is a Walker’s Paradise so daily errands do not require a car.
Bleecker Street is a five minute walk from the M QNS BLVD-6th AVE/ Myrtle Local at the Broadway-Lafayette St stop.
This location is in the Greenwich Village neighborhood in Manhattan. Nearby parks include Gould Plaza, NoHo Historic District and MacDougal-Sullivan Gardens Historic District.
